Homemade Cranberry Orange Muffins
Course Breakfast
Cuisine American
Servings 6

Equipment

  • Food Processor

Ingredients
  

  • 2 Cups all purpose flour
  • 3/4 cup sugar
  • 2 tsp baking powder
  • 1 beaten egg
  • 1 tsp. grated orange peel
  • 2/3 cup of orange juice
  • 1/2 cup of oil
  • 1 cup of coarsely chopped cranberries 1 bag of dried cranberries
  • 1/2 cup of chopped nuts optional
  • 1 tbsp of sugar to sprinkle on top before baking

Instructions
 

  • Mix flour, salt, sugar and baking powder. In separate bowl beat egg, orange peel, orange juice and oil. Stir into flour mixture until moistened. Fold in cranberries and nut. Put into large muffin tins and sprinkle with sugar if desired. Cool for 5 minutes then remove from pan. Makes 6 large muffins.

Muffins are a quick and easy breakfast on days that you are on the go. These Cranberry Orange muffins are delicious with a touch of sugar sprinkled on top. They always remind me of Fall but you could make them anytime.

They are beautiful in a glass pedestal and complimented by vanilla yogurt for breakfast. Also a tip I found is to use fresh squeezed orange juice if possible. Makes them even better!
